How Troubleshooting Your Frigidaire Dryer: Why It’s Not Heating Up Actually Works

At its core, a dryer fails to heat when the system cannot properly generate or distribute thermal energy. Modern Frigidaire models rely on an electric heating element, thermostat controls, and signaling sensors—all working in sequence. When one part malfunctions, the entire circuit is interrupted.

A common culprit is a faulty heating element, often worn from daily use or triggered by electrical surges. Another frequent issue is a malfunctioning thermostat, which may fail to detect proper temperatures or send correct signals. Blocked or damaged air vents disrupt heat circulation, while improper venting or localized moisture buildup can interfere with sensor accuracy. Even sensor calibration errors—triggered by dust, debris, or component wear—may halt output prematurely.

By isolating these components through basic diagnostics—checking fuses, testing thermostat response, and verifying vent clearance—users can determine whether a repair, reset, or service visit is needed. This step-by-step approach prevents confusion and ensures targeted solutions.

Common Questions People Have About Troubleshooting Your Frigidaire Dryer: Why It’s Not Heating Up

Why does the dryer power up but never get hot?
The element may fail to reach temperature due to a broken heating coil, insufficient voltage, or thermostat misalignment. Resetting the dryer or testing the heating element can clarify this.

Is a blown fuse the problem?
Yes—blown or tripped fuses cut power to critical components, stopping heating. Resetting resets the circuit; a repeated burnout signals deeper issues.

Can dirty components affect heating?
Absolutely. Dust and lint block airflow, trapping heat and confusing sensors. Regular cleaning of lint traps and vents improves reliability.
